As movement is progressing in the states and from further north, many questions relating to home made nectar are showing up on various web sites. A few questions on some very large web sites are seemingly aimed at harming birds, for what ever reason. Below is generally accepted as default recipe.

Use pure white cane sugar ONLY,.....no substitutes
Ratio of 4 parts water to 1 part pure white cane sugar ONLY,.no substitutes
Please do not use any type of red food coloring in hummingbird nectar
Food coloring has been found to be possibly harmful to hummingbirds
and unnecessary as an attractant.

This page from Cornell/Audubon All about Birds, covers in extensive detail.

Red food coloring may be harmful to hummingbirds--I don't believe there's direct proof one way or the other. But it's certainly useless and should be eschewed for that reason alone. Flower nectar is colorless & is generally hidden away in the depths of the flower so the hummer never sees it anyway.

Nobody in their right mind would want to test dyes directly on hummingbirds, but the research on them [dyes] strongly suggests a potential for harm in the quantities hummingbirds consume. A few years back, my friend and fellow hummingbird bander Stacy Jon Peterson summarized a number of medical studies on the health effects of synthetic red dyes and how the results relate to hummingbirds. His site is defunct, but the page is still available through the magic of the Wayback Machine:

Trochilids RED DYE page

Science backs you on that. A study published last year suggests that once hummingbirds learn where the sugar source is, it doesn't matter much what color it is as long as it stays put. (The title of the linked article is an overstatement, though - they do use color to find flowers and feeders in the first place but appear to associate resource quality with location rather than with color differences.)

Try asking them if they'd be willing to eat/drink 130 packets of unsweetened strawberry Kool-Aid every day. That would give a 175-pound person a dose of Red 40 similar to that in a hummingbird's average daily intake in bright red feeder solution.

Some of my friends and I have been known to do a little guerrilla education by sidling up to fellow shoppers looking at "instant nectar" and asking them if they know that one part white sugar to four parts water is cheaper, more convenient, better tasting*, and recommended by hummingbird experts. ;)

* Informal backyard tests suggest that the birds don't like the taste of the dye.

As a biologist, hummingbird bander, and former zookeeper, I'm curious as to how you'd design either a banding study or a non-lethal captive study to address the toxicity of dyes with results rigorous enough to prompt an unprecedented regulatory decision (if there are any legal restrictions in the U.S. on food additives in products intended for wild animals, I've never been able to find them). Keeping the free-living hummingbirds away from flowers and other feeders and keeping the captive hummingbirds alive and otherwise healthy long enough to demonstrate adverse effects from the dye are just two of many challenges.

Then I guess it's a good thing my "propaganda" is supported by peer-reviewed "gut feelings": Shimada et al. 2010, Sasaki et al. 2002, Tsuda et al. 2001, Voorhees et al. 1983, Kobylewski and Jacobson 2012, etc. There are more references at the link I posted above, and the chapters on FD&C Reds Nos. 3 and 40 in this publication from the Center for Science in the Public Interest summarize the science behind the broader controversy over the safety of these additives.
